HPD: Officers shoot man who shot at them while responding to burglary call at west Houston apartments

Houston police said they were dispatched to the Flats on Tanglewilde around 3:30 p.m. after a woman saw three masked people entering her unit on a doorbell camera.

HOUSTON — A man was shot by Houston Police Department officers on Wednesday in west Houston.

It happened when officers responded to a burglary call at the Flats on Tanglewilde apartments on Tanglewilde Street just north of Westheimer Road near Gessner Road.

Police said they were dispatched around 3:30 p.m. Wednesday after a woman called police to say she saw three masked people entering her unit on a doorbell camera. She also called a family member.

The two officers who arrived at the scene were unaware a family member was also called, according to police.

Officials said the family member raised his firearm and shot at officers and officers returned fire, hitting the man in the leg. The officers weren't hit.

The officers later approached the family member and applied a tourniquet to help stop the bleeding. He was transported to an area hospital and was expected to survive.

His motive for shooting officers is unknown at this time, according to police.

Police said some of the bullets struck other apartments, but no one else was injured.

People who live in the apartment complex told KHOU 11 News reporter Katiera Winfrey they saw emergency personnel take one person out of the apartment in a stretcher from the second-floor elevator.

They said it was a frightening scene because they weren't used to seeing that type of police presence in their building.

“I just came home from work I came in and I’m walking into my apartment and there’s a flood of police officers and then we just heard like four or five really loud gunshots in the hallway," resident Haven Pleasant said.

The masked men who broke into the apartment got away. Police did not say if anything was stolen.

Per HPD policy, the officers were placed on administrative leave and bodycam footage will released within 30 days.
